  2. As i saw the "Tea Thread", i thought we deserved a coffee one. Right now i am in to Turkish Coffee. Bought myself a Turkish coffee pot like this: got myself some Memet Efendi Coffee Got some Cardamom Pods (one pod per pot). 2 spoons of coffee in the pot. Add sugar to suit. Add cardamom pod. stir well. gently bring to just below boil and you get the nice froth on top. do not touch the coffee once on the heat. i have it black, or sometimes a tiny dash of milk, looks like this when its about ready: the really nice thing about it, is that if done right, even black, it isnt bitter at all, lovely way to do coffee imo.
